
One of the titles in a series of topographic maps of popular walking & recreational areas of New Zealand with contours at 20m intervals & relief shading. Perennial snow & ice contours are marked in blue & terrain information
Includes:: cliffs, saddles, moraine, scree, forest, scrub, etc. The maps show tracks & footpaths, with some paths indicating walking distances between marked points. A range of symbols depict campsites, huts, shelters, toilets & parking areas, fuel supplies, places of interest, etc. Latitude & longitude margin ticks are at 1' intervals, & the New Zealand Map Grid is printed over the map. In this title: detailed topographic mapping of Mount Cook & adjacent ranges. The map is centred on the Tasman Glacier & extends out to the towns of Fox Glacier & Aoraki in the north & south, & to the Liebig Range & the Sierra Range in the east & west respectively.
